Select Brand:

Show All


€81.06

Dispatch on next business day

€63.23

Dispatch on next business day

€50.21

Dispatch on next business day

€51.23

Dispatch on next business day

€114.61

dispatch in 5 business days

€74.26

dispatch in 5 business days

€109.87

dispatch in 28 business days

€110.20

dispatch in 28 business days